Exact Sciences Corporation (EXAS) develops and commercialises non‑invasive cancer screening tests, best known for Cologuard, a stool‑based colorectal cancer screening product. Investors should know the company’s growth depends on test adoption, reimbursement from insurers and its ability to expand into other cancer diagnostics through product launches and acquisitions. Revenue has historically been driven by screening volumes, pricing and payer coverage; margins can improve as fixed costs scale but may be pressured by marketing and R&D investment. Key risks include regulatory and reimbursement uncertainty, competition from lab and diagnostic rivals, and execution challenges in commercial expansion and new test development. The stock can be volatile and is sensitive to changes in clinical data, guideline updates and policy decisions. Adaptive Biotechnologies Corporation is a commercial-stage company. The Company focuses on the field of immune medicine by harnessing the inherent biology of the adaptive immune system to transform the diagnosis and treatment of disease. Its immune medicine platform applies its technologies to read the genetic code of a patient's immune system. It operates through two segments, which include Minimal Residual Disease (MRD) and Immune Medicine. The MRD business focuses on the use of its sensitive, next-generation sequencing (NGS) assay to measure MRD in patients with hematologic malignancies. Its MRD business is comprised of its clonoSEQ clinical diagnostic testing service, offered to clinicians. Its Immune Medicine business focuses on immune-repertoire sequencing, target antigen discovery, data licensing and TCR-antigen prediction models in the identification, validation, development and adoption of products and services.

Explore BasketWhy You’ll Want to Watch This Stock
Screening growth potential
Colorectal screening adoption and expanded guidelines could drive volume, though uptake depends on reimbursement and patient behaviour, so outcomes can vary.
Expanding global reach
International roll‑out and partnerships may open new markets, but regulatory hurdles and local payer systems can slow progress and add uncertainty.
Pipeline and innovation
R&D and acquisitions aim to broaden cancer detection offerings; promising data can boost prospects, while negative results or delays present downside risk.
